Introduction
Most of the main menus in Cubase have key command 
shortcuts for certain items on the menus. In addition, there 
are numerous other Cubase functions that can be per
-
formed via key commands. These are all default settings.
You can customize existing key commands to your liking, 
and also add commands for many menu items and func
-
tions that currently have no key command assigned.

Loading earlier key commands settings 
If you have saved key commands settings with an earlier 
program version, it is possible to use them in this Cubase 
version, by using the “Import Key Command File” function, 
which lets you load and apply saved key commands or 
macros: 
1.Open the Key Commands dialog.
2.Click the “Import Key Command File” button to the 
right of the Presets pop-up menu.
A standard file dialog opens.
